FLUX is a family of text-to-image generative AI models developed by Black Forest Labs, a company founded in 2024 by researchers formerly associated with Stability AI.[1] The models generate photorealistic images from text prompts and are known for their strong text rendering, prompt adherence, and support for image editing through reference images.[2] FLUX models are built on a rectified flow transformer architecture and are offered in both open-weight and proprietary commercial variants, making them a widely used alternative to systems such as Stable Diffusion, Midjourney, and DALL-E.[1][4]
History
Black Forest Labs was founded in 2024 by Robin Rombach and other researchers who had previously worked on the Stable Diffusion series at Stability AI.[1] The company released the first FLUX.1 models in August 2024 in three variants: FLUX.1 Schnell, an Apache 2.0 licensed open-weight model optimised for speed; FLUX.1 Dev, a higher-quality open-weight model released under a non-commercial licence; and FLUX.1 Pro, a commercial model available through an API.[1] The open-weight releases were widely adopted by the open-source community and quickly became the default choice for local image generation.
In November 2025 the company released the FLUX.2 family, anchored by FLUX.2 Dev, a 32-billion-parameter model released under the FLUX.2-dev non-commercial licence, capable of both text-to-image generation and multi-reference image editing.[2][4] FLUX.2 introduced multi-reference support combining up to ten images into a novel output, output resolution up to 4 megapixels, pose control, and substantially improved typography.[3][5] In January 2026 the company released the FLUX.2 Klein family, its fastest models, capable of sub-second generation on consumer GPUs.[2]
Key Concepts
FLUX models are rectified flow transformers: they use the flow matching framework, in which a neural network learns a vector field that transports noise to data along nearly straight paths, allowing high-quality generation in a small number of sampling steps.[1][4] This architecture descends directly from the research behind Stable Diffusion 3 and is shared with other frontier generative systems.
A distinctive feature of the family is the range of variants optimised for different trade-offs. The FLUX.2 lineup spans Klein (fast, sub-second inference for prototyping), Flex (fine-grained control with a configurable number of steps), Pro (production at scale), and Max (highest quality, with web search grounding for real-time information).[5] The models are released with responsible-development safeguards; Black Forest Labs states that prior to release it evaluated checkpoints and hosted services for risks including unlawful content, and implemented pre-release mitigations.[4]
Applications and Impact
FLUX is used for creative and commercial image generation, including marketing assets, product visualisation, game art, and design mockups, with its reliable text rendering making it well suited for infographics, user interfaces, and multilingual content.[3] Open-weight variants have spawned a large ecosystem of fine-tunes, LoRA adapters, and third-party hosting platforms, and the models are available on major model-serving services and through NVIDIA-optimised deployments that support FP8 quantisation for reduced memory use.[6] The FLUX.2 release was noted for setting a new standard among open-weight image models across text-to-image, single-reference editing, and multi-reference editing benchmarks.[5]

FLUX is accessible to Malaysian creators through free open-weight downloads for local use and through commercial APIs offered by model-hosting platforms, making it a popular choice for local designers, advertising agencies, and e-commerce sellers producing product imagery and marketing content for platforms such as Shopee and Lazada. Malaysia's digital economy agency MDEC encourages local creative industries to adopt generative AI, and the National AI Office (NAIO) promotes responsible adoption of such technologies.[7][8] Malaysian businesses using FLUX should also consider copyright and intellectual property rules for AI-generated content, as well as the Personal Data Protection Act (PDPA) when generating images that depict identifiable individuals.
